Charcoal vs. Activated Charcoal: Understanding the Key Differences and Benefits
Charcoal is a lightweight black residue produced by strongly heating wood in minimal oxygen. Activated charcoal is charcoal that has been treated to increase its adsorptive properties, making it highly porous.
